I don't know what MI's tax situation is like, so I can't comment on the price. I know you could get both for about $10 less online before shipping, but the two tins would probably be about the same as you paid off the shelf here in MN.

Those are two pretty nice blends. The DeLuxe mixture is a very good aromatic and EMP is a staple in many experienced pipe smokers' rotations. Neither is exceptionally strong or bold, but they're composed of high quality tobacco and pleasant smokes.

If it smoked well right out of the tin, consider yourself lucky. ;)

If it is at a good moisture level for smoking, smoke the tin up within a week or two or put it into a mason jar or some other airtight vessel (you can leave it in the tin and just put the whole thing in a freezer bag, too) to maintain that moisture level. Experiment a little one bowl at a time and see if you like the tobacco as is or if drying helps. It's all part of the fun.
